Also Nearby

212 Race Street

Philadelphia, PA

1200 Callowhill Street

Philadelphia, PA

4943 Germantown Ave

Philadelphia, PA

2101 North Front Street

Philadelphia, PA

Random Listing

3576 Arlington Avenue Suite 105

Riverside, CA

145 East 32nd Street Floor 6

New York, NY

1604 Miriam Street

Pittsburgh, PA

502 South Still Road Suite 102

Sequim, WA

21075 SWenson Drive Suite 600

Waukesha, WI

Focus House in Philadelphia

Below are details for Focus House, an alcohol treatment center offering their services around Philadelphia

Name : Focus House

Address : 701 North 63rd Street

Zip/Postcode : 19151

Phone : (215)477-0063

Fax :

Email :

Offering : Rehabilitation Services




Is this listing incorrect?

Please help us keep upto date information on Focus House. Click here to submit an update

Update this Information

Want to upgrade your listing?

Is Focus House your business? Click here to learn about premium listings

Upgrade your listing